A new video for the previously unreleased Tom Petty track “Something Could Happen” is now available.

Embedded below, the video stars The Walking Dead‘s Lauren Cohan whose attempt at decluttering her home following a breakup leads her down a magical path to healing her broken heart.

“Something Could Happen” received an official release in October on the Wildflowers and All the Rest reissue released by the Petty estate. The reissue was available in a variety of bundles and formats, including a massive Super Deluxe Edition made up of 5 CDs and 9 LPs totaling 70 tracks, nine unreleased songs and 34 unreleased versions. The “All the Rest” portion of the reissue was made up of ten songs leftover from the Wildflowers recording sessions. Of those ten, five were previously unreleased tracks.
